Josephine (Jodi) Trujillo

Born on Christmas Day at the family home at Barr Lake, Colorado to Charles Casey Chavez and Cora Walker Chavez. Jodi, also known as “Dolly” to her friends and family, was one of twelve children.

She was a Brighton High School graduate in 1952 and retired from Samsonite Luggage in the 70’s.  She was also a seamstress for Blinky of Blinky’s Clubhouse.  Jodi bowled in several women’s bowling leagues for many years.  She was the original Mrs. Clause in Brighton for over ten years.  She went on to become a restaurant /bar owner at the Brothers II Lounge for over forty years; famously known for her lunch specials and Sunday morning breakfasts and menudo. 

After high school Jodi married her first husband John Trujillo, Jr. and together they had six children.  After his passing, she met the love of her life Ernest (Bob) Rojo.  They were together for over fifty years.  They enjoyed fishing, camping, traveling and taking road trips in their motorhome.  When they traveled they would always go with their close friends and family.

She was involved in her community by catering the Brighton DECA functions and making sure to take some extra chili with her.  She was an avid Broncos fan and season ticket holder.  The family would get together at her house for the super bowls and holiday dinners where she would always burn the buns.
